| 成果简介 | NOVELTY - The system has a passive infrared (PIR) sensor for detecting restroom occupancy and triggering monitoring of environmental parameters in real time. An ammonia sensor monitors air quality to detect unpleasant smells. A pH sensor ensures that the water in urinals and toilets remains within optimal pH levels to prevent odors caused by improper decomposition. A turbidity sensor measures clarity of water used for flushing and cleaning to detect contamination or impurities. A global system for mobile communication (GSM)module alerts to maintenance staff when environmental parameter exceeds preset threshold value, indicates the need for immediate action. USE - Smart sanitation system designed for improving hygiene and cleanliness of large-scale restrooms in differen places e.g.. educational institutions. Uses include but are not limited to healthcare, hospitality, workplaces, public infrastructure, retail and industrial settings, corporate facilities, and public spaces. ADVANTAGE - The system ensures smart sanitize to minimize manual supervision, optimizes restroom maintenance schedules, and enhances the overall sanitation standards in public and institutional restrooms by providing real-time monitoring and automated alerts. The system automatically generates a cleaning alert, which is transmitted t to maintenance personnel through a mobile notification when parameters exceed predefined thresholds, thus ensuring timely intervention to maintain cleanliness and hygiene.
